In Australia, a full time Dump Truck Operator generally earns $1,720 per week ($89,440 annual salary) before tax. This is a median figure for full-time employees and should be considered a guide only. As you gain more experience you can expect a potentially higher salary than people who are new to the industry.

The number of people working in this industry has decreased in recent years. There are currently 32,300 people employed as a Dump Truck Operator in Australia compared to 37,200 five years ago. Dump Truck Operators may find work across all regions of Australia.

Source: Australian Government Labour Market Insights

If you’re planning a career as a Dump Truck Operator, consider enrolling in a Certificate II in Surface Extraction Operations. This course will explore safety procedures and risk controls at open cut mines and quarries and cover other topics such as operational skills for machinery, vehicles and equipment.

For those looking to embark on a rewarding career in the mining and construction sectors, pursuing Dump Truck Operator courses in Toowoomba is an excellent starting point. The region is well-known for its vibrant industry, providing ample opportunities for qualified professionals. Courses such as the Certificate III in Civil Construction Plant Operations RII30820 and Certificate II in Surface Extraction Operations RII20220 are designed specifically for beginners without any prior experience. These qualifications will equip you with the necessary skills to operate dump trucks safely and efficiently.

The training landscape in Toowoomba offers a variety of courses tailored to the unique demands of dump truck operations. Among the popular choices are the Certificate III in Driving Operations TLI31222 and the Conduct Rigid Haul Truck Operations RIIMPO338E. Each course is recognised by relevant industry bodies, ensuring that you receive high-quality training. Enrolling in any of these programs not only prepares you for roles as a dump truck operator but opens doors to various related careers, including positions as a Plant Operator and Mechanical Fitter.
